pouët.net

Go to bottom

bümp mäpping by Ümlaüt Design [web]

 ////////////////////////////////////////////////////////////////////////////
 /            þ þ                       þ þ                                 /
 /     ÛÛÛ   Û   Û ÛÛÛÛ  ÛÛÛÛÛ   ±±±±  ±±±±± ±±±±± ±±±±± ± ±±±±  ±±±±±      /
 /     Û  Û  Û   Û Û Û Û Û   Û   ± ± ± ±   ± ±   ± ±   ± ± ±   ± ±          /
 /     ÛÛÛÛÛ Û   Û Û Û Û ÛÛÛÛÛ   ± ± ± ±±±±± ±±±±± ±±±±± ± ±   ± ± ±±±      /
 /     Û   Û Û   Û Û   Û Û       ±   ± ±   ± ±     ±     ± ±   ± ±   ±      /
 /     ÛÛÛÛÛ ÛÛÛÛÛ Û   Û Û       ±   ± ±   ± ±     ±     ± ±   ± ±±±±±      /
 /                                                                          /
 ////////////////////////////////////////////////////////////////////////////

                     4K lameness by Gargaj/šmlat Design

 Contents
 ~~~~~~~~
 I. Story
 II. Greets and other stuff

 I. Story
 ~~~~~~~~
 Well, since you know the group's story very well (you read our website,
 didn't you?), I'll tell you about the story of this...well, bad thing.
 First off, it all started, when I downloaded Freestyle 8., the AI diskmag,
 and in the coder section, I read a pretty self-explaining bump routine by
 Murphy/Exact. I especially liked bump mapping, since I think bump is one of
 the most useable routines, and it can be done easily. Well, when D-lee of
 Exceed told me, that without a team, I should do 4K or 64K intros, I started
 thinking about a 4K. Firstly, I saw clearly that 3D is outta sight for me,
 since my old, soggy brain couldn't understand that damned 3D math routines.
 So much for 3D. I recently talked about it to Procyon and D'Soft, and D'Soft
 clearly stated that he won't take part in it. Procyon was happy to join the
 work, and I wanted to make him do the harder part, the bump :). But after
 many months of waiting and no code, I sat down, and started coding. I hadn't
 discovered ASM fully yet (Old, soggy brain (OSB) sucks), so I made a plan:
 First, I make a spine in TP, and then I translate it into ASM. Later the ASM
 fell out, when I saw E2K by Digital Dynamite on FLaG 2000 (full Pascal
 demo). I thought that nobody made any TP 4K-s yet, so why not? If it sucks,
 the prejury will filter it, am I right? So I sat down (usually, that's the
 way I code: I persuade myself to sit down, and away it goes.), and started
 coding. After a nice, but very lame attempt I recoded most of the source,
 and told Procyon to code a routine, that retrieves the system font. Same
 effect, nothing for weeks. Later I talked to Procyon, he said his family
 didn't let him code, and I found out that he was actually learning for his
 state exam in German. Poor dude. Viel glck. Well, it seemed to me, that I'm
 the only one staniding. All right, let's rock the boat a little. I coded,
 and coded, and coded, until one day, the pre-bump spotlight routine vanished
 and a bump took his place. The problem was the size. It was well over 4K
 (10K to be precise). But when I compiled it with TPC, It became 4,5K!!!
 Well, I thought, that's nice, guess I have to compress it. Later, on IRC,
 Ebola said, that the spotlight's boring, how about changing colors. OK, I
 said, and off it went. Then I received a heart attack: It became 6K. I
 rewrote the routine, so it became slower, but smaller (And my brain started
 to get dry :) ). With WWP compression, it became less than 4K. What does
 the C7007 partypeople think about it? That depends on the future. Hope they
 appreciate it. Well, we WILL see...
 Oh yeah, and the source is included. This also means no hidden parts. Sorry.

 II. Greets 'n' stuff
 ~~~~~~~~~~~~~~~~~~~~
 Greets and thanks go to...
 ... Bas van Gaalen. Pascal Rules.
 ... Exceed. A huge thanks for keeping the feeling alive. Miskolc r00lz.
 ... the rest of šmlat Design. Shame you didn't join the coding.
 ... the d00dz at irc.hu #demoscene. See ya beetween 3pm-5pm CET on Sat-Sun.

 To find out group info, check UMLAUT.NFO. If it's not in the ZIP, then
 say a big hiho to the C7007 organizers.
Go to top